Linux下如何查看定位当前正在运行软件的配置文件
2024-08-25 04:34:11
netstat命令
用于显示与IP、TCP、UDP和ICMP协议相关的统计数据,一般用于检验本机各端口的网络连接情况
netstat -lntup
说明: l:listening n:num t:tcp u:udp p:process
- 查看nginx的PID,以常用的80端口为例:
[root@xiaoyuer scripts]# netstat -lntup|grep 80
tcp 0 0 0.0.0.0:80 0.0.0.0:* LISTEN 13309/nginx
可以知道nginx进程是13309
- 通过相应的进程ID(比如:13309)查询当前运行的nginx路径:
[root@xiaoyuer scripts]# ll /proc/13309/exe
lrwxrwxrwx 1 root root 0 Jan 4 17:02 /proc/13309/exe -> /data/nginx/sbin/nginx
3. 获取到nginx的执行路径后,使用-t参数即可获取该进程对应的配置文件路径,如:
/usr/local/nginx/sbin/nginx -t
nginx: the configuration file /usr/local/nginx/conf/nginx.conf syntax is ok
nginx: configuration file /usr/local/nginx/conf/nginx.conf test is successful
其实所有的启动命令都是类似
最新文章
- ACM练手
- js 中的算法题,那些经常看到的
- c++11之bind
- Unity3d之MonoBehaviour的可重写函数整理
- Java判断空字符串
- 使用Vitamio打造自己的Android万能播放器(7)——在线播放(下载视频)
- Java调用摄像头截图
- Autofac 入门
- 有向图的邻接矩阵表示法(创建,DFS,BFS)
- shell编程其实真的很简单(三)
- vue-项目入门
- R语言︱机器学习模型评价指标+(转)模型出错的四大原因及如何纠错
- Spring Boot 集成 Swagger,生成接口文档就这么简单!
- boston_housing-多分类问题
- 1.7 All components require plug-in?
- 使用 Composer 安装Laravel扩展包的几种方法
- javascript 迭代与递归
- MYSQL 中query_cache_size小结
- Centos7配置JAVA_HOME
- Log4j中conversionPattern的含义
热门文章
- 屌炸天,像写代码一样写PPT,一个小工具解决
- 【题解】coin HDU2884 多重背包
- 《面试补习》- Java集合知识梳理
- 通过PLSQL创建Database link,DBMS_Job,Procedure,实现Oracle跨库传输数据
- 其他:什么是元数据?(Metadata)?
- 1.3.6、通过Path匹配
- 在Xshell中文件内容显示乱码
- <;clinit>;() 和 <;init>;()
- Jenkins+Sonar 项目构建前代码审查
- konga的初步使用